软件开发外包合同是一份法律文件,它规定了双方在合作过程中的权利和义务。为了确保这份合同的有效性,需要遵循以下步骤:
1. 选择合适的律师或法律顾问:在签订合同之前,最好咨询一位专业的律师或法律顾问,以确保合同的内容符合法律法规的要求,并且能够保护双方的利益。
2. 阅读并理解合同内容:在签订合同之前,务必仔细阅读合同的每一条款,了解其中的权利和义务。如果有任何疑问或不确定的地方,可以向律师或法律顾问请教。
3. 确保合同条款明确、具体:合同中的条款应该清晰、具体,避免模糊不清的表述。例如,合同中应该明确指出开发周期、交付物、费用支付方式等关键事项。
4. 确认合同的合法性:在签订合同之前,要确保合同的内容不违反任何法律法规。如果有疑问,可以向律师或法律顾问请教。
5. 双方签字盖章:在合同上签字并盖章,表示双方同意合同的内容,并对合同承担相应的法律责任。
6. 保存合同副本:将合同的副本保存好,以备后续查阅或作为证据使用。
7. 注意保密条款:在签订合同时,要注意合同中的保密条款,确保双方遵守保密义务,不得泄露合同内容。
8. 定期审查合同:在合作过程中,要定期审查合同的执行情况,确保合同的条款得到履行,如有需要,可以与律师或法律顾问沟通,对合同进行修改或补充。
9. 解决争议:如果在合作过程中出现争议,要及时与律师或法律顾问沟通,寻求解决方案。如果无法协商解决,可以考虑通过仲裁或诉讼等方式解决争议。
总之,签订一份有效的软件开发外包合同需要仔细阅读合同内容,确保合同条款明确、具体,并且合法合规。在签订合同后,要定期审查合同的执行情况,及时解决可能出现的问题。